HARDEN OFF TENDER PLANTS
IT’S too early to plant frost-tender seedlings and non hardy plants outside.
Frost is still possible until late May — or June in cold regions. Tender plants fresh from a greenhouse must be toughened up for an outdoor life.
The easiest way is to place your plants somewhere outside which is well-lit, but sheltered. Cover them at night when low temperatures are forecast. If you keep them in shallow boxes or trays, those are easy to cover with horticultural fleece, pictured, if necessary.
